Upon directives of the Saudi leadership, Minister of Defense Prince Khalid bin Salman bin Abdulaziz held a meeting on Monday with Emir of Qatar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al Thani, the Saudi Press Agency said.
The minister conveyed the greetings of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ques King Salman bin Abdulaziz Al Saud and of Prince Mohammed bin Salman bin Abdulaziz Al Saud, Crown Prince and Prime Minister, wishing the Qatari Emir, government, and people continued progress and prosperity.
The Qatari Emir sent his greetings and appreciation to the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ques and the Crown Prince.
Discussions focused on the strong fraternal ties between the two countries and explored avenues to bolster security and stability in the region.
Present at the meeting were prominent officials from both sides. The Saudi delegation included Minister of Transport and Logistic Services Saleh Al-Jasser, and Director-General of the Office of the Minister of Defense Hisham bin Abdulaziz bin Saif.
The Qatari delegation included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of State for Defense Affairs Khalid Al Attiyah, Chief of the Emiri Diwan Sheikh Saoud bin Abdulrahman Al Thani, and Minister of Transport Jassim bin Saif bin Ahmed Al Sulaiti.

Saudi Minister of Foreign Affairs Prince Faisal bin Farhan bin Abdullah made a telephone call on Sunday to Iran's Minister of Foreign Affairs Seyed Abbas Araghchi, SPA reported.
The Saudi minister congratulated his Iranian counterpart on his new position and wished him success.

The ministers discussed relations and explored ways to strengthen cooperation across various sectors.
They underscored the importance of continued coordination and dialogue to advance ties and exchanged views on the evolving situation in the Gaza Strip.
